Understanding the Benefits of Sweet Potatoes
Sweet potatoes are often celebrated for their rich nutritional profile. They are packed with vitamins A, C, and B6, as well as dietary fiber and potassium. Consuming sweet potatoes can support eye health, boost the immune system, and promote digestive health. Their natural sweetness makes them a popular choice for a variety of dishes, from savory to sweet.
In addition to their health benefits, sweet potatoes are low in calories and high in carbohydrates, making them a great energy source. They can be enjoyed in numerous ways, but microwaving is one of the quickest and most efficient cooking methods. This technique preserves the nutrients and flavor while ensuring a tender texture.
Preparation Steps for Microwaving Sweet Potatoes
Before you begin the microwaving process, proper preparation is essential to achieve the best results. Follow these steps to prepare your sweet potatoes effectively.
Selecting the Right Sweet Potato
Choosing the right sweet potato is crucial. Look for ones that are firm, smooth, and free of blemishes. The size of the sweet potato can affect cooking time, so consider selecting medium-sized potatoes for even cooking.
Washing and Scrubbing
Before cooking, it’s important to wash and scrub your sweet potatoes thoroughly. This removes any dirt or pesticides that may be present on the skin. Rinse under cool running water and use a vegetable brush to scrub the surface gently.
Pricking the Skin
To prevent the sweet potato from bursting in the microwave, use a fork to prick holes all over the skin. This step allows steam to escape during cooking, ensuring even heat distribution.
How to Microwave a Sweet Potato: Step-by-Step Guide
Now that your sweet potatoes are prepared, it’s time to microwave them. Follow this step-by-step guide for the best results.
Step 1: Place the Sweet Potato in the Microwave
Place the prepared sweet potato on a microwave-safe plate. If you are cooking more than one sweet potato, ensure they are spaced out to allow for even cooking.
Step 2: Cooking Time
Microwave the sweet potato on high for a specific duration based on its size. As a general guideline, use the following cooking times:
- Small sweet potato (4–5 ounces): 4–5 minutes
- Medium sweet potato (6–8 ounces): 6–8 minutes
- Large sweet potato (9–12 ounces): 8–12 minutes
It is advisable to start with the minimum time and check for doneness. You can always add more time if necessary.
Step 3: Checking for Doneness
After the initial cooking time, carefully remove the sweet potato from the microwave using oven mitts, as it will be hot. Check for doneness by inserting a fork or knife into the center. The sweet potato should be tender and easily pierced. If it’s still firm, return it to the microwave in 1-minute increments until fully cooked.
Step 4: Letting it Rest
Once cooked, let the sweet potato rest for a few minutes. This allows the steam to continue cooking the potato slightly and makes it easier to handle.
Tips for Perfectly Microwaved Sweet Potatoes
To ensure your sweet potatoes come out perfectly every time, consider these helpful tips.
Use a Microwave Cover
Using a microwave-safe cover or a damp paper towel can help retain moisture during cooking and prevent the skin from drying out.
Rotate for Even Cooking
If your microwave does not have a turntable, manually rotate the sweet potato halfway through cooking. This helps achieve even cooking on all sides.
Experiment with Seasoning
After microwaving, the sweet potato can be enhanced with various toppings or seasonings. Consider adding butter, cinnamon, or brown sugar for a sweet treat, or olive oil and herbs for a savory option.
Serving Suggestions for Microwaved Sweet Potatoes
Microwaved sweet potatoes can be served in numerous ways, making them a versatile addition to any meal.
Sweet Potato Mash
After cooking, mash the sweet potato with butter, salt, and pepper for a delicious side dish. This method retains the natural sweetness while adding creaminess.
Stuffed Sweet Potatoes
For a more filling option, cut the sweet potato open and stuff it with toppings such as black beans, cheese, or sautéed vegetables. This creates a nutritious meal that is both satisfying and flavorful.
Sweet Potato Fries
Slice the microwaved sweet potato into wedges, season with your favorite spices, and finish them off in the oven for a crispy texture. This alternative offers a healthier take on traditional fries.
